## ScanBridge — Environments

ScanBridge connects the Ostermark warehouse scanners to the Lanternly inventory API. There are two environments: sandbox, which talks to simulated scanner firmware, and production, which talks to live devices. Reviewers should note that timeout and retry settings differ deliberately between the two, since real hardware is slower. The production configuration currently in effect is as follows.

config for yawep-tajef:
[kelion]
team = kelys
access_code = ac_1a130d
owner = holax.aldmir
host = kelion.urlaqforge.example
port = 9090
peer = fenmir.lumicio.example
salt = d0dd3cb5
pin = 3295

## Further reading

So you've inherited the great cron exodus. We're moving all the old crontab jobs from the Mossfen boxes into Weftrunner, our workflow engine, and honestly it's mostly better — retries, visibility, no more mystery 3 a.m. failures. But during the transition, some jobs run in both places, so check the migration tracker before you kill anything. The dedupe guard catches most double-runs, not all. The full migration plan, job-by-job status, and rollback notes live on the internal page below.

operations page: https://jenkins.zemvarcloud.local/job/merge_requests/repo/build/73930b4b30f0a8ed

**Deploy step 4 — LiftPath Simulator**

New folks: the Hollowgate elevator-dispatch simulator will not start its scenario scheduler without credentials for the traffic model service. After cloning the repo and copying `env.sample` to `.env`, set `SIM_BUILDING_PROFILE=tower-a` and `DISPATCH_MODE=realtime`. Then, on the very next line of the file, add the scheduler's access secret.

sealed setting: VAULT_KEY20=c8ea1e419912889df6b4